Luna Announces Hearing on MKULTRA Experiments and Its Impact on Public Trust
Published: Jun 23, 2026
WASHINGTON—Task Force on the Declassification of Federal Secrets Chairwoman Anna Paulina Luna (R-Fla.) today announced a hearing on “Mind Control and Accountability: Uncovering the Truth of the CIA’s MKULTRA Experiments.” During the hearing, members will examine the history and timeline of the Central Intelligence Agency’s (CIA) MKULTRA project and its original classification and how the project meets the CIA’s obligation to protect the United States. Members will also analyze the intelligence community’s unwillingness to declassify information related to MKULTRA and how the lack of transparency has reduced Americans’ trust in government institutions.
“The intelligence community has covered up the nature and classification of the MKULTRA experiments for decades. Americans have been misdirected repeatedly and deserve transparency and accountability from the CIA. The intelligence community’s unwillingness to deliver the truth has fueled dangerous conspiracy theories and eroded public trust in the federal government. This hearing aims to explore the history of the MKULTRA experiments, how they have impacted Americans’ wellbeing, and how the intelligence community can win back trust,” said Task Force Chairwoman Luna.
WHAT: “Mind Control and Accountability: Uncovering the Truth of the CIA’s MKULTRA Experiments”
DATE: Tuesday, June 30, 2026
TIME: 10:00 a.m. EST
LOCATION: 2154 Rayburn House Office Building
WITNESSES:
- Stephen Kinzer, Senior Fellow in International and Public Affairs, Brown University
- Tom O’Neill, Investigative Journalist, Author of Chaos: Charles Manson, the CIA, and the Secret History of the Sixties
WATCH: This hearing is open to the public and will be livestreamed here.

Wireless Body Area Network Combined with Satellite Communication for Remote Medical and Healthcare Applications
Huan-Bang Li · Takashi Takahashi ·
Masahiro Toyoda · Yasuyuki Mori · Ryuji Kohno
Published online: 1 July 2009
https://www.academia.edu/108518655/Wireless_Body_Area_Network_Combined_with_Satellite_Communication_for_Remote_Medical_and_Healthcare_Applications?email_work_card=title
Abstract
Wireless Body Area Network (WBAN) is expected to play an important role in supporting medical and healthcare services with increased convenience and comfort. One main advantage of WBAN is that it enables automatic biosignal collection in real time which is essential in medical treatment and healthcare vigilance. To harmonize with the strong demands from both medical and healthcare societies, and information and communications technology industries, IEEE 802 Standard Committee set up a task group of TG15.6 to develop an IEEE wireless standard on WBAN. In this paper, we first review the main activities of TG15.6 with the updated status. Then, we present a prototype WBAN system that is implemented by using ultra-wideband technology. Multi-hop mechanism is adopted to guarantee reliable connection. Finally, we describe an experimental system that uses the developed WBAN system by combining with satellite communication in supporting remote medical treatment and healthcare. | Medical implant communications system (MICS) is allocated to the same 402-405 MHz in most countries or regions, while wireless medical telemetry system (WMTS) is allocated with different frequency bands. Industrial, scientific and medical (ISM) band and ultra-wideband (UWB) band are available world wide although regulations on UWB are different in countries and regions. Some main frequency candidates for WBAN are:
– MICS band: 402–405 MHz, USA, EU, Korea, Japan, 10 channels of 300 kHz, adaptive frequency agility and 25uW EIRP.
– Med Radio: EU and FCC proposed band 401–402 MHz and 405–406 MHz.
– WMTS band: different in countries and regions. The FCC definition is 608–614 MHz,
1395–1400 MHz, and 1427–1432 MHz.
– ISM bands: 868/915 MHz, 2.4, 5.8 GHz.
– UWB band: different in countries and regions. The FCC definition is 3.1–10.6 GHz
